## Deployment

The Addrly widget ships as a single bundle. Build with `make dist`, push to the Kestrelbay CDN bucket, then bump the version pin in the host app. No blue-green needed; the widget is stateless. Smoke-test autocomplete against the staging geocoder before promoting. Rollback is just re-pinning the previous version. Don't touch the suggestion cache TTLs without checking with Priya's team first. The staging environment expects the following configuration values.

settings of fawip-yadug:
[druath]
port = 3000
region = north-4
host = druath.qirvanworks.corp
timeout_ms = 1500
retries = 1

**Ticket: Chip reader rejecting signed firmware**

The Pacefield timing-chip readers at the Harrowton Marathon refuse the 4.1 firmware — signature check fails on boot. Root cause: build pipeline signed with the retired key after last month's rotation. Patch re-signs the artifact and pins the verifier to the current key. Please review against the key below.

deploy key for kajof-fajop: bky6_gDHw9Q

## Changelog — Digestron 4.2

Changed defaults: batch email digests now assemble at the top of each hour instead of every 15 minutes, and the per-recipient coalescing window doubled. This reduces send-queue churn overnight. If pages fire about digest lag, check against the new defaults first, which are listed here.

settings of tagef-bawif:
DRUIX_HOST=druix.zemvarlabs.internal
DRUIX_PORT=8000